Implants are used to replace a missing tooth. An implant consists of a surgical steel implant post, with a steel abutment topped by a porcelain crown. This long-term solution fits, feels, and functions like a normal tooth.
When we are missing a tooth for a prolonged period of time, we experience bone loss, or resorption, in that part of the jaw. When significant bone resorption occurs, it may affect adjacent teeth, making them unstable as well. In addition, adjacent teeth will shift, affecting occlusion and bite health. This can result in plaque and tartar buildup, cavities, TMD and periodontal disease (see our Invisalign section for a more in-depth explanation of bite-health and its importance). Finally, missing teeth can affect speech and chewing, and implants in highly visible locations have a cosmetic purpose as well.
